  1. Byram went from £27m player to a 750k player overnight it seems - https://www.bbc.co.uk/sport/football/49319480 Premier League new boys Norwich City got the steal of the summer. They bought Sam Byram from West Ham for just £747,000. He was valued at £27.7m by the selling club but is significantly lower for Norwich at £7m. They have still secured a player with Premier League experience for just over 10% of his monetary value though.
